Can you be long and short the same option?

In summary, there is little or no advantage to being both long and short the exact same option. The two positions net to zero. There could potentially be a violation of exchange rules. Last, there is probably more cost than benefit due to commissions coupled with bid-ask spreads.

How long should you hold a short stock?

You can maintain the short position (meaning hold on to the borrowed shares) for as long as you need, whether that's a few hours or a few weeks. Just remember you're paying interest on those borrowed shares for as long as you hold them, and you'll need to maintain the margin requirements throughout the period, too.

Is short riskier than long?

Key Takeaways

Short selling is riskier than going long because there's no limit to the amount you could lose. Speculators short sell to capitalize on a decline. Hedgers go short to protect gains or to minimize losses.

Is it easier to short or long stocks?

Long trades involve buying then selling assets to profit from an increase in the asset's price. Short trades involve selling a borrowed security and buying it back at a lower price profit from the decrease in its price. Short trades can be much riskier than long trades, so they should be left to experienced investors.

What is the penalty for short selling?

If a seller is unable to deliver the promised shares, they will be charged the difference between the auction's settlement price and their original selling price. Furthermore, an auction penalty of 0.05% per day is levied for each day the shares remain undelivered.

Has a stock ever come back from 0?

Can a stock ever rebound after it has gone to zero? Yes, but unlikely. A more typical example is the corporate shell gets zeroed and a new company is vended [sold] into the shell (the legal entity that remains after the bankruptcy) and the company begins trading again.

How much cash do you need to short a stock?

The standard margin requirement is 150%, which means that you have to come up with 50% of the proceeds that would accrue to you from shorting a stock. 1 So if you want to short sell 100 shares of a stock trading at $10, you have to put in $500 as margin in your account.
